Liquidation is the selling of the assets of a business, paying bills and dividing the remainder among shareholders, partners or other investors. A business need not be insolvent to liquidate.

Montana Liquidation of Partnership with Authority, Rights and Obligations during Liquidation: Montana liquidation of partnership refers to the process of winding up the affairs and operations of a partnership in the state of Montana. The liquidation process involves the distribution of the partnership's assets and settlement of its obligations. Authority during Liquidation: During the liquidation process, the authority to make decisions and act on behalf of the partnership is usually vested in the partners, unless otherwise specified in the partnership agreement. Partners have the power to sell or transfer partnership assets, settle debts, and enter into any necessary agreements. However, it is important to note that any major decisions or significant actions should be made with the consent of all partners involved, unless otherwise agreed upon. Rights during Liquidation: Partners have specific rights during the liquidation process, which ensure they receive fair treatment and their interests are protected. These rights include the right to participate in the liquidation process, the right to inspect and audit the partnership's financial records, and the right to receive their share of the partnership's assets after all obligations have been settled. Obligations during Liquidation: Partners also have certain obligations during the liquidation process. They are responsible for fulfilling any remaining partnership obligations, such as paying off debts, resolving legal disputes, and terminating any ongoing contracts or agreements. Partners must work together to ensure that all outstanding obligations are settled appropriately. Types of Montana Liquidation of Partnership: There are different types of liquidation of partnership in Montana, depending on the circumstances and the decision of the partners. They include voluntary liquidation, where the partners mutually decide to wind up the partnership, and involuntary liquidation, which occurs when a partner files a lawsuit or a court order mandates the dissolution of the partnership. In voluntary liquidation, partners have more control over the process and can proactively plan and execute the liquidation. On the other hand, involuntary liquidation usually happens when there are disputes among partners or if one partner has breached the partnership agreement in some way. In order to dissolve a partnership, the following four accounting steps must be executed: sell noncash assets; allocate any gains or losses arising from the sale based on the partnership agreement; pay off liabilities; distribute the remaining funds based on capital account balances of the partners.

Simply put, a dissolution is a (typically) voluntary legal closure of a business while a liquidation involves the selling of a company's assets in order to pay creditors.

Generally, however, the liquidators of a partnership pay non-partner creditors first, followed by partners who are also creditors of the partnership. If any assets remain after satisfying these obligations, then partners who have contributed capital to the partnership are entitled to their capital contributions.

Definition: Partnership liquidation is the process of closing the partnership and distributing its assets. Many times partners choose to dissolve and liquidate their partnerships to start new ventures. Other times, partnerships go bankrupt and are forced to liquidate in order to pay off their creditors.

In general, the statement of net assets in liquidation, which replaces the balance sheet, is presented in an unclassified format with the excess of assets over liabilities shown as a single amount designated net assets in liquidation (or vice versa if liabilities exceed assets).

A partnership liquidation happens where the partners have decided that the partnership has no viable future or purpose, and a decision may be made to cease trading and wind up the business.

The statement of partnership liquidation is prepared to depict the progress of the liquidation over the specified period of time. Here, the assets of the partnership entity are sold off to pay off the entire liabilities and if any balance is left thereafter, it is shared among the partners as per the pre-agreed ratio.
